Construction Dumpster Rental in Park City - Do You Need One?

Although local governments often provide waste disposal services, very few of them will haul away building debris. That makes it important for individuals to rent dumpsters so they can dispose of waste during construction endeavors.

The most typical exception to this rule is when you've got a truck that is big enough to transport all building deb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. In case you're working on a small bathroom remodeling project, for instance, you could find you could fit all the debris in a truck bed.

Other than quite little projects, it is strongly recommended that you rent a dumpster in Park City for building projects.

If you're not sure whether your municipality accepts building debris, contact the city for more info. You will likely find that you will need to rent a dumpster in Park City. Setting debris outside for garbage removal could potentially lead to fines.


20 yard dumpster measurements in Park City

A 20 yard dumpster can hold about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Standard measurements for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these measurements, a 20 yard dumpster can hold about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This means that the 20-yarder is a common size for occupations that involve cleaning from larger projects. Due to the compact size that still has capacity for a good volume of debris, a 20 yard container is one of typically the most popular dumpster sizes for house jobs.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container contain:

  • Cleanup from a basement, loft or garage
  • Flooring and carpeting removal from a big house
  • 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
  • 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of

What You Need To Expect to Spend on your Dumpster Rental in Park City

The amount of money that you spend renting a dumpster in Park City will depend on several variables.

The size of the dumpster is a important factor that will impact your rental fees. Smaller dumpsters are more often than not more economical than bigger ones.

The period of time that you need to keep the renting dumpster in Park City will also influence the cost. The more time you keep the dumpster, the more you can expect to pay.

Services are another factor that could affect your overall cost. Many companies include services like dumpster drop off and pick up in their costs. Some companies, however, fee for all these services. This makes it important that you ask about any hidden fees.

Finally, you will need to pay higher costs for disposing of certain materials. In the event you would like to add tires or appliances to the dumpster, for instance, you can expect to pay a little more.


40 yard dumpster dimensions

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ions aren't perfectly conventional from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the biggest size that a lot of dumpster firms typically rent, so it is ideal for large residential projects in addition to for commercial and industrial use.

A 40 yard container will hold between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the total amount of waste and debris which could fit in this container include:

  • Waste from a window or siding replacement for a large home
  • A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
  • New construction or a major improvement to a large home
  • Big am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and trash

Choosing the top dumpster for your job size

Picking the top dumpster for your job is an important aspect of renting dumpster in Park City. Should you pick a dumpster that is too little, you will not have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you will have to schedule extra trips. In the event that you select one that is too big, you will save time, but you will squander cash.

Should you call a renting dumpster business in Park City and describe the job for which you need a dumpster, they can advocate the finest size. Their years of experience mean that they generally get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ster usually functions well for moderate-sized cleaning projects and small rem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the best choice for big dwelling cleaning projects and moderate-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ls that are perfect for a home cleanout or remodeling jobs on a sizable house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ively big and are used only on the largest projects including new construction.


What if I need my dumpster in Park City picked up early?

When you make arrangements to rent a dumpster in Park City, part of your rental agreement contains a stated length of time you're permitted to use the container. You normally base this time on how long you think your project might take. The larger the project, the the more time you will need the dumpster. Most renting dumpster companies in Park City give you a rate for a specific amount of days. If you surpass that quantity of days, you will pay another fee daily. In case the project goes more rapidly than expected, you might be finished with the dumpster earlier than you anticipated.

If that is the case, give the dumpster company a call and they'll likely come pick your container up early; this will allow them to rent it to someone else more quickly. You usually will not get a reduction on your rate should you ask for early pick-up. Your rental fee includes 7 days (or whatever your term is), whether you use them all or not.

Long-Term vs Roll-off dumpsters

Whether or not you desire a long-term or roll-off dumpster depends on the kind of job and service you'll need. Permanent dumpster service is for continuous demands that last longer than just a day or two. This includes matters like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is exactly what the name indicates; a one-time need for project-special waste removal.

Temporary rolloff d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be properly used. These are usually bigger containers that could manage all the waste which is included with that particular job. Permanent dumpsters are usually smaller containers as they are em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.

Should you request a permanent dumpster, some companies need at least a one-year service agreement for this dumpster. Roll-off dumpsters just need a rental fee for the time that you keep the dumpster on the job.


What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Job?

Choosing a dumpster size demands some educated guesswork. It is often problematic for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, realistically, they have no idea how much stuff their roofs contain.

There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you can follow to make an excellent option. If you're removing a commercial roof, then you'll probably need a dumpster that offers you at least 40 square yards.

If you're working on residential roofing job,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ably want a 20-yard dumpster.

A lot of folks order one size bigger than they think their endeavors will require because they want to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ing full dumpsters which weren't large enough.
